创建加油小程序需要什么条件
-
2026-06-12
昆明
- 返回列表
在移动互联网深度渗透各行各业的目前,线上服务已成为提升商业效率与用户体验的关键。对于加油站行业而言,开发一款专属的小程序,不仅是拓展线上渠道、贴近用户需求的必然选择,更是实现服务智能化、管理精细化的重要工具。从构想到落地,一个功能完善、运行稳定的加油小程序的诞生,并非一蹴而就,它需要满足一系列明确的技术、资质与设计条件。本文将系统性地剖析创建一款加油小程序所需具备的核心条件,为有志于此的开启者或企业提供一份清晰的路线图。
一、 基础资质与平台准入条件
开发小程序,首先需要满足平台方的准入要求。目前,微信小程序是蕞主流的选择之一。
1. 主体资质认证
开启者必须拥有合法的主体资格。对于企业而言,需要完成企业类型的微信公众平台注册与认证,通常需要提供营业执照、对公账户等信息。个人开启者虽然也可以注册,但部分涉及商业交易与服务类目(如加油、支付)的功能将受到严格限制甚至无法开通。计划进行商业化运营的加油小程序,必须以企业为主体进行注册和认证。
2. 服务类目审核
小程序提供的服务必须与其所选的服务类目严格对应。加油、能源销售类服务属于特定类目,提交审核时,需要确保小程序的实际功能与所选类目完全一致。平台会对此进行严格审核,任何功能与类目不符、或类目选择不当的情况,都会导致审核失败。小程序首页必须能直观体现或通过有限次点击(通常要求两次以内)到达所有已提交的服务类目页面,确保服务透明、可及。
3. 遵守平台协议与规范
开启者需全面阅读并同意《微信小程序平台服务条款》等相关协议。条款中明确要求,小程序的功能应具有实际使用价值,不能过于简单;不得提供与微信客户端相同或类似的功能(如朋友圈);未经授权不得展示或推荐第三方小程序。更重要的是,所有功能必须合法合规,不得包含任何违法违规信息。平台会对提交发布的小程序进行包括安全测试、UI测试、动态测试在内的多维度审核,只有通过审核,小程序才能正式发布上线。
二、 核心技术能力要求
一款加油小程序是前端交互、后端逻辑与数据管理的综合体,对开发团队的技术栈有明确要求。
1. 前端开发技能
小程序前端开发基于特定的框架,但其核心技术与Web开发一脉相承。开启者必须熟练掌握HTML、CSS和JavaScript这三项基础技能。HTML用于构建页面结构,CSS负责样式布局与美化,而JavaScript则实现页面的交互逻辑与动态效果。还需要深入理解小程序独有的框架(如微信小程序的WXML、WXSS)及其生命周期、事件系统、组件和模板的使用方法。对于追求跨平台一致性的团队,也可以考虑使用Uni-App等支持多端输出的框架,以提高开发效率。
2. 后端与数据库技术
后端负责处理业务逻辑、用户管理、订单处理、支付对接及与数据库交互等核心任务。常见的后端开发语言包括Java、PHP、Python等。例如,采用PHP结合ThinkPHP这类成熟框架,可以快速构建稳定的后端服务。数据库方面,MySQL因其开源、性能稳定和社区活跃,是许多项目的优选。后端开发需要设计合理的API接口,确保与前端小程序进行安全、高效的数据通信。
3. 第三方服务集成能力
加油小程序的核心功能高度依赖第三方服务:
地图与定位服务:必须集成高精度地图API(如腾讯地图、高德地图),实现加油站的快速定位、周边搜索、路线导航与地理围栏等功能,这是提升用户体验的基础。
支付系统:必须安全、稳定地集成微信支付、支付宝等支付渠道,实现订单的快速结算。这涉及支付接口的调用、签名验证、回调处理以及资金安全策略的实施。
数据加密与安全:在传输用户敏感信息(如位置、支付数据)时,必须使用HTTPS等加密技术,防止数据泄露和篡改,保障用户隐私与资金安全。
三、 核心功能模块设计条件
功能设计直接决定小程序的实用性与竞争力。一个完整的加油小程序应具备以下模块:
1. 用户端功能设计
智能推荐与搜索:基于用户实时地理位置(LBS),结合油价、加油站品牌、服务评价、距离等多维度数据,智能排序并推荐相当好加油站。
油站信息清晰展示:需设计页面完整展示加油站的名称、位置、实时油价(在政策允许范围内)、营业时间、服务项目(如是否提供洗车、便利店)、用户评分与评论等。
在线支付与订单管理:支持用户选择油枪、油品、金额,并在线完成支付,生成电子订单。用户应能方便地查看历史订单、订单状态及消费明细。
会员与营销体系:设计积分系统、优惠券(如满减券、折扣券)、充值卡以及会员等级制度,以提升用户粘性和复购率。
交互与反馈:提供收藏加油站、一键导航、在线客服、服务评价与投诉等功能。
2. 加油站端(商家端)功能设计
油站信息管理:允许加油站管理者后台维护本店信息,包括油价调整(需考虑合规性)、服务内容更新、营业状态设置等。
订单与流水管理:实时查看和核对该站的加油订单、交易流水,支持订单查询、统计报表生成,便于财务对账。
营销活动管理:可在后台创建和管理面向用户的促销活动,如限时折扣、会员日优惠等,并监控活动效果。
3. 平台管理后台设计
需要一个雄厚的后台管理系统,用于平台方的全局管控,包括用户管理、加油站入驻审核与管理、全平台订单监控、优惠券与活动配置、数据统计分析(如用户增长、交易趋势、热力图)以及内容审核(如用户评论)等功能。
四、 用户体验与性能保障条件
良好的用户体验是留存用户的关键,这要求开发过程必须注重设计与性能优化。
1. 界面与交互设计
UI设计需要遵循简洁、直观的原则,色彩搭配应符合品牌调性且不刺眼,布局要符合用户操作习惯。交互流程应力求顺畅,减少不必要的跳转和输入。例如,从选择油站到完成支付,步骤应清晰且尽可能简化。
2. 性能优化
小程序的首屏加载速度、页面切换流畅度直接影响用户体验。开发中需注意:优化图片和资源大小,合理使用本地缓存减少请求,对复杂数据进行分页加载,以及避免执行长时间阻塞线程的JavaScript操作。小程序平台提供的性能监控工具应被充分利用,以持续分析和优化性能瓶颈。
3. 测试与调试
在上线前,必须进行全面的测试,包括功能测试(确保所有功能按设计运行)、兼容性测试(在不同型号手机和微信版本上运行正常)、性能测试(压力下的响应速度)以及安全测试。通过反复的调试,修复潜在的Bug,确保上线后的稳定运行。
五、 开发资源与周期评估
开发资源取决于所选择的路径。
1. 自主开发团队
需要组建一个包含产品经理、UI/UX设计师、前端开发工程师、后端开发工程师、测试工程师的完整团队。对于一款功能完备的加油小程序,从需求分析、设计、开发到测试上线的完整周期,通常需要3至6个月,具体时间因功能复杂度和团队经验而异。
2. 使用第三方开发平台或外包
对于没有技术团队或希望快速上线的商家,可以选择成熟的SaaS化小程序制作平台或委托专业软件外包公司。这种方式可以大幅降低技术门槛和初期投入,可能将上线周期缩短至数周。但需要注意,这种方式在功能的定制化程度和后续迭代的灵活性上可能受到一定限制。
创建一款成功的加油小程序,是一个涉及平台合规、技术实现、产品设计和运营准备的系统性工程。它要求开启者或企业首先跨越平台资质审核的门槛,继而组建或获取涵盖前端、后端、数据库及第三方服务集成的技术能力。在功能规划上,必须围绕用户找站、比价、支付的核心需求,以及商家的管理、营销需求进行周密设计。流畅的交互体验、稳定的性能表现和严谨的安全保障,是支撑小程序长期健康运行的基础。充分理解并满足这些条件,是加油站行业迈向数字化、智能化服务的关键一步。
加油小程序电话
在线咨询扫码 · 获取加油小程序报价
致力于创造可持续增长的解决方案和服务





